I've watched this film so many times and I still love to watch it. From an early age I considered this to be one of my favourite films and having gone out and bought the DVD I still love it. It's a spectacular film, with magnificent special effects and a classic good versus evil story line.

The main character, Willow Ufgood (Warwick Davies- plays many other famous and often not acknowledged parts such as Wicket in "Star wars" and marvin the paranoid android in "hitch hikers guide to the galaxy") (the best PC word I know) a dwarf, lives in a village with similar people. He's married happily with two kids, life is simple but good. Then he finds a baby floating down the river and things change. He is given the task of taking the baby to a tall people's or "Daikini" village. What he doesn't know is that this baby is special and is destined to overthrow an evil ruling sorceress. Because the forces of good don't want this baby to fall into evil hands Willow is given help from fairies, brownies and in particular a cocky swordsman called Madmartigan (played by Val Kilmer). Cue a spectacular battle between the forces of good and the forces of evil as they vie for possession of the baby.

This film is made by George Lucas and Ron Howard, so you know its in good hands and it will be full of great special effects. With creatures such a trolls ("I hate trolls!"), two headed dragon beasts, brownies, fairies and characters that are great sorcerers and fantastical swordsmen this film is well and truly in the "lord of the rings" type fantasy realm. The brownies add a dose of humour and even Val Kilmer has some funny moments. It's all massive fun. Also an interesting fact is that Val Kilmers love interest played by Joanne Walley went on to be his wife after this.

Although aimed mainly at children its fun for all ages. I love it, the action is superb, the swordplay awesome, special effects are great (the scene where they are turned into pigs is really scary). If you like fantasy films or have children this is just the film for you. I really can't fault it, it's just a really good wholesome film.

Special features on the DVD include:
Feature commentary by Warwick Davies
2 Featurettes "willow:making of an adventure" and "morf to morphing:the dawn of digital filmmaking"
trailer
2 teasers
8 tv spots
still gallery
intereactive menus
scene access

As you can see this DVD has a wealth of extras and all of them are a great addition to the DVD. The two featurettes are entertaining and interesting and Warwick Davies commentary is one of the best I've heard.
